Amy Pemberton
Amy Louise Pemberton is a British actress. She portrays Gideon in the television series Legends of Tomorrow[1] and voiced Elaena Glenmore in the Game of Thrones video game.[2] She voiced Slone from Titanfall 2 (2016), and played Private Sally Morgan—a companion of the Seventh Doctor—in Big Finish Productions' Doctor Who audio plays.

Personal life
Pemberton is from Stowmarket, Suffolk.[3] Her father died in 2009.[4]
